A Cork man was jailed for 12 years yesterday for breaking into the home of a father of six and stabbing him with a Stanley knife, carving an X on the victim's back.

William Hogan (41), from Annalea Grove, Mayfield, Cork, pleaded guilty to assault causing harm to Mr John O'Carroll on March 21st, 2000.
